Ketamine induces rapid antidepressant effects via the autophagy-NLRP3 inflammasome pathway.

Our findings demonstrate that sub-anesthetic doses of ketamine exert their antidepressant-like effects by inhibiting inflammation and initiating neuroprotection via autophagy activation. These data might help expand future investigations on the antidepressant properties of ketamine.
